💡
原文中文,约4500字,阅读约需11分钟。
📝
内容提要
本文介绍了从Jekyll转换到Pelican的方法,并在GitHub的pages服务上发布Pelican网站。作者选择Pelican作为静态网站发布工具,因为它的文档和样式丰富。文章提供了两种基于GitHub的pages服务发布网站的方法,并详细介绍了作者的操作步骤。最后,作者分享了使用Pelican时遇到的问题和解决方法。
🎯
关键要点
- 本文介绍了从Jekyll迁移到Pelican的方法。
- 作者选择Pelican作为静态网站发布工具,因为其文档和样式丰富。
- 文章提供了两种基于GitHub的pages服务发布网站的方法。
- 详细介绍了作者的操作步骤,包括建立本地撰写环境和编译静态网站。
- 作者分享了在使用Pelican时遇到的问题及解决方法。
- Pelican的配置简单,只需配置pelicanconf.py和在content目录中写作。
- 首次建立本地环境时,作者使用了两个仓库进行测试和发布。
- 使用Python脚本快速完成Jekyll到Pelican的文章转换。
- 作者定制了自动化发布流程,简化了日常维护。
- 在配置中,注意不要清除output目录,以免影响发布。
- 遇到DISQUS配置问题,发现SITEURL的配置决定性。
- 处理分类RSS链接时,使用内置对象的slug属性解决了问题。
- 作者添加了作者信息和章节索引功能,增强了网站的可用性。
➡️